Are people in Bethlehem older or younger than people in Coatesville?
- The Median Age in Bethlehem is 4.4 years older than in Coatesville.

Are housing costs cheaper in Bethlehem or Coatesville?
- Bethlehem housing costs are 2.9% less expensive than Coatesville hous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Bethlehem or Coatesville?
- The average commute for residents of Bethlehem is 2.3 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Coatesville.

Things to do in Bethlehem?
Bethlehem, Pennsylvania is a vibrant city located in the Eastern region of the United States. Home to attractions such as The Lehigh Valley Zoo and Illick's Mill Park, visitors can explore outdoor activities and historical sites when visiting Bethlehem. There are also plenty of museums, galleries, and performance venues such as The Moravian Museum of Bethlehem and The Musikfest Cafe.For entertainment, visitors can explore boutique shops and restaurants along with movie theaters and live music clubs.
